This one surprised us and turned out much better than expected despite minimal ingredients. What do you do with some extra brats in your freezer, a bit of leftover cabbage, a few potatoes, and some apples you’re not going to snack on? Throw them together in a skillet!

Preparation

  1. Brown all sides of the brats in a big skillet or Dutch oven on medium high heat. 
  2. If there’s not enough oil from the sausages, add some olive oil. Sauté the onion until tender.
  3. While the onion cooks, cube the potatoes into small chunks (¼ -½”) and add to the pan. 
  4. While the potato cooks, core and slice the cabbage to about ¼” thickness. Add it to the pan. 
  5. While the cabbage cooks, quarter and core the apples. Chop to ½” pieces. Add the apple and cook until the apple is tender but not mushy. 
  6. Remove from heat, stir in vinegar, and season to taste with salt and pepper. 
  7. Serve with your favorite mustard.

Ingredients

Yield: 4 servings

4 brats, thawed

1 Tbsp olive oil

1 large onion 

3 small potatoes

1 small head of cabbage

2 medium apples (tart is better)

2 Tbsp apple cider vinegar

Salt and pepper to taste

Favorite mustard
